What is the Intransigent Warhammer in BG3?

In Baldur’s Gate 3, the Intransigent Warhammer is an early game weapon that has a fantastic perk that has a chance to knock other enemies prone. Impulse Blast is triggered whenever you kill an enemy or when you land a Critical Hit. Consequently, this will cause other nearby attackers to become Prone. Prone is a status condition where a target is knocked down, and they cannot move or take any actions until they get a chance to stand up on their next turn. Any attacks against them have Advantage.

Intransigent Warhammer Abilites and Effects

Below are all the features, abilities, and effects of the Intransigent Warhammer in Baldur’s Gate 3:

  • Weapon Type: Warhammer
  • Damage: 1d10 (1d8)+1 Bludgeoning
  • Requirements: Martial Weapons Proficiency
  • Rarity: Uncommon
  • Location: Taken from the Watertight Chest on a Duergar skiff as you sail to the Grymforge, Act a.
  • Weight: 5.4 kg
  • Value: 100
  • Bonuses:
    • Impulse Blast: You knock nearby foes Prone after killing a hostile target or landing a Critical Hit.
  • Classes with Martial Weapons Proficiency: Barbarian, Fighter, Paladin, and Ranger
  • Companions Who Can Use This Weapon: Karlach, Lae’zel, Minthara, Minsc

How to Get Intransigent Warhammer in Baldur’s Gate 3

Baldur's Gate 3 Boat to Travel to Grymforge from the Underdark

To get the Intransigent Warhammer in Baldur’s Gate 3 you will need to initiate combat with the other boat while riding the Duergar skiff to the Grymforge, and open the Watertight Chest on the enemy boat during the fight. First you’ll need to find your way into the Underdark during Act 1. There are several access points but we recommend using the Well in the center of the Blighted Village. Go down the well into the Whispering Depths, find the glowing green chasm and defeat the Phase Spider Matriarch, then cast Feather Fall and jump into the glowing hole. Then you’ll be down in the Underdark.

BG3 How to Get to Grymforge

Within the Underdark you will be looking for the Decrepit Village. There will be a beach and some small docks where you can find a Duergar boat. To use it you will either have to defeat the Duergar stationed in the village, or find the Boots of Speed for them.

Then, once you board the boat you will automatically start to travel to the Grymforge. On the way, you will be intercepted by another boat with Duergar who will question you. If you initiate combat, a fight will start between the two groups across the water. Choose a party member with decent Athletics and have them jump across to the other boat on the far left end. There you will find a Watertight Chest. It is not locked or trapped and you can easily open it to get the Intransigent Warhammer.

How to Use the Intransigent Warhammer in BG3

You can use the Intransigent Hammer either in one hand or with two hands. Using it with one hand will have it deal 1d8+Str modifier damage, while two-handed will deal 1d10+Str modifier. It functions as a normal warhammer and then can also knock enemies prone using its Impulse Blast ability. For the Impulse Blast ability to activate, the wielder must either score a critical hit or kill their target. Nearby creatures must succeed a DC 14 Dexterity saving throw or be knocked prone by the Impulse Blast when it activates.

Tips and Tricks of the Intransigent Warhammer in BG3

Here are some Tips and Tricks for using the Intransigent Warhammer in Baldur’s Gate 3:

  • Make sure that whatever character is using the Intransigent Warhammer is proficient with warhammers so they can utilize its special weapon actions.
  • Remember that the weapon can be wielded either one-handed or two-handed, making it great for defensive and offensive characters.
  • Make good use of the prone enemies it creates.

FAQs for Intransigent Warhammer in Baldur’s Gate 3

Who should use the Intransigent Warhammer?

Fighters, Paladins, and Clerics using the War Domain are all great choices for using the Intransigent Warhammer.

Can you dual-wield the Intransigent Warhammer?

No, as the Intransigent hammer is not a light weapon. It can be wielded either one or two-handed due to its versatile property.
